This course is suitable for all examination boards.
Our Spanish revision course is skill-specific as opposed to board or topic specific. The aim of this course is:
- develop understanding of the spoken and written forms of Spanish in a range of contexts;
- develop the ability to communicate effectively in Spanish, through both the spoken and written word, using a range of vocabulary and structures;
- develop knowledge and understanding of the grammar of Spanish, and the ability to apply it;
- apply their knowledge and understanding in a variety of relevant contexts which reflect their previous learning and maturity;
- develop knowledge and understanding of countries and communities where Spanish is spoken;
- develop positive attitudes to Spanish learning;
- provide a suitable foundation for further study and/or practical use of Spanish.
Each morning and afternoon session incorporates practice of the following examination skills drawing upon AS level material or utilising A2 level material:
- Speaking: oral exams; presentation; general conversation.
- Listening comprehension
- Reading comprehension
- Writing: short and long responses; essay writing and task-based responses.
In each session emphasis is placed on areas of grammar that commonly cause students problems. Students are set exercises to prepare, paragraphs to write and sentences to translate and are encouraged to memorise key vocabulary and use idiomatic structures in the target language.
Addressing the language component (75-85%) of A level modern language specifications, the course does not give specific coverage to set texts and set topics. Where students specifically want help on Spanish literature texts, this can usually be accommodated by means of individual tuition.
